
Senior Compensation Analyst
Job Summary: Talent Software Services is in search of a Senior Compensation Analyst for a contract position in MN(Remote). The opportunity will be three months with a strong chance for a long-term extension.
Primary Responsibilities/Accountabilities:
- Performs the highest level of compensation support through design, analytics, and execution of new and existing pay program(s) and practices.
- Focus is on providing consultative-level compensation services: designs pay program(s) and practices to meet the organization's needs, creates business processes to bring program(s) and practices into operation, collaboratively completes job evaluations/market pricing, large scale department reorganizations, and equity reviews.
- Participates in projects and leads large scale project work.
- Uses advanced Excel skills to perform and present complex compensation data analytics.
Qualifications:
- Sr. Compensation Analyst
- Experience developing data models / analysis
- Preference with healthcare experience, but not required
- We are in need of an experienced compensation consultant who can also model data effectively.
- We're developing a new compensation model for ~15,000 employees in a specific segment, and a skillset to be able to model what/if analysis would be helpful.
- We will plan to post a permanent role, but it will realistically take a while to find a replacement, and there are some key work and deliverables we'll want this resource to help out with.
- Bachelor's degree in human resources, business, or related field.
